Car Insurance Increases After a Ticket For Racing, Minimum Car Insurance Required In Your State, Most And Least Expensive Vehicles To Insure, $10 state penalty assessment for every $10 or part thereof of base fine, $7 county penalty assessment for every $10 or part thereof of base fine, $5 state DNA Identification fund for every $10 or part thereof of base fine, $5 state courthouse facilities construction fund for every $10 or part thereof of base fine, $2 county emergency medical services (EMS) fund for every $10 or part thereof of base fine, Surcharge fee equal to 20% of your base fine, $4 emergency medical air transportation (EMAT) fee, How to pay the fine or contest the ticket. how to fight a traffic ticket in California, Report of Out-of-State Traffic Conviction by a Commercial Driver.
